Ahmed A. Alammar is a scholar working on Mechanical Engineering, Renewable Energy, Sustainability and the Environment and Aerospace Engineering. According to data from OpenAlex, Ahmed A. Alammar has authored 9 papers receiving a total of 323 indexed citations (citations by other indexed papers that have themselves been cited), including 9 papers in Mechanical Engineering, 5 papers in Renewable Energy, Sustainability and the Environment and 2 papers in Aerospace Engineering. Recurrent topics in Ahmed A. Alammar’s work include Heat Transfer and Boiling Studies (5 papers), Heat Transfer and Optimization (5 papers) and Solar Thermal and Photovoltaic Systems (4 papers). Ahmed A. Alammar is often cited by papers focused on Heat Transfer and Boiling Studies (5 papers), Heat Transfer and Optimization (5 papers) and Solar Thermal and Photovoltaic Systems (4 papers). Ahmed A. Alammar collaborates with scholars based in United Kingdom, Israel and Iraq. Ahmed A. Alammar's co-authors include Saad Mahmoud, Raya Al-Dadah, Hameed B. Mahood, Anees A. Khadom, Mustafa S. Mahdi, Fadhel Noraldeen Al-Mousawi, Richard Hood, Stephanie Decker, Ahmed Rezk and Abed Alaswad and has published in prestigious journals such as Journal of Cleaner Production, Energy Conversion and Management and Energy.
